SubjectRe: [PATCH] iio: adc: stm32-dfsdm: Fix the uninitialized use if regmap_read() fails
On Sun, 8 Aug 2021 18:32:43 +0100
Jonathan Cameron <jic23@kernel.org> wrote:

> On Sat, 24 Jul 2021 16:48:40 +0100
> Jonathan Cameron <jic23@kernel.org> wrote:
>
> > On Mon, 19 Jul 2021 19:53:11 +0000
> > Yizhuo <yzhai003@ucr.edu> wrote:
> >
> > > Inside function stm32_dfsdm_irq(), the variable "status", "int_en"
> > > could be uninitialized if the regmap_read() fails and returns an error
> > > code. However, they are directly used in the later context to decide
> > > the control flow, which is potentially unsafe.
> > >
> > > Fixes: e2e6771c64625 ("IIO: ADC: add STM32 DFSDM sigma delta ADC support")
> > >
> > > Signed-off-by: Yizhuo <yzhai003@ucr.edu>
> >
> > Hi Yizhou
> >
> > I want to get some review of this from people familiar with the
> > hardware as there is a small possibility your reordering might have
> > introduced a problem.
>
> To stm32 people, can someone take a look at this?

This one is still outstanding. If anyone from stm32 side of things could take a look
that would be great,

Jonathan
